Elephant Castle With His Sparkling Track “Quicksand”

Upcoming artist Elephant Castle is the retro-inspired indie-rock project from Los Angeles-based singer and multi-instrumentalist Phil Danyew, formed in late 2019. The first single, “Cool To Be Unhappy,” was released on March 27, 2020, with a warm welcome.
